Add a bike carrier or cargo carrier with this dual hitch receiver.


Features:

  • Allows you to use a hitch-mounted bike rack or cargo carrier while towing your vehicle
  • Constructed of sturdy steel
  • Resists rust and corrosion with durable powder coat finish
  • Requires pin and clip or hitch lock (sold separately)


Specs:

  • Application: 2" x 2" trailer hitches
    • Dual receivers have 2" x 2" openings
  • Drop: 2" or 10"
  • Rise: 2" or 10"
  • Gross towing weight: 10,000 lbs
  • Tongue weight: 400 lbs
  • Overall shank length: 13"
  • Hitch pin hole diameter: 5/8"
  • Limited lifetime warranty


Dimensions of Receiver Adapter

Note: Not for use when towing a trailer.

  • Distance Between Hitch Openings of Roadmaster Dual Hitch Receiver Adapter # RM-077-10
    The rise/drop of the Roadmaster Dual Hitch Receiver Adapter # RM-077-10 is the distance from the top of the shank that slides into the vehicle hitch to the top of the receiver openings. So when the adapter is in the drop position and the lower opening is the longer one the distance is 10 inches from the top of the shank to the top of the lower opening and then 2 inches to the upper opening. If you flip the adapter the distance is then also 10 inches of rise and 2 inches of drop. Since...

  • Is Roadmaster Dual Hitch Adapter Class 3 Rated
    The Roadmaster Dual Hitch Receiver Adapter, 2" or 10" Drop/Rise # RM-077-10 is not Class 3 rated because only hitches are rated by class as opposed to any adapter. And for question two, actual weight is pretty irrelevant in all honesty; Roadmaster's engineers have determined the # RM-077-10 is able to withstand the very fluid ride of a flat towed vehicle and its smooth suspension but not the extremely rough, bouncing, constant motion of a trailer and its very basic suspension.

  • Recommended Dual Hitch Adapter and Cargo Carrier for Flat Towing/Carrying Bike Rack and Cargo Carrie
    You can use a Dual Hitch Adapter like # RM-077-2 so you can simultaneously carry a cargo carrier/bike rack and flat tow. There are a couple things to keep in mind, though... Using an adapter will reduce the tongue weight capacity of the hitch by half. Therefore, if the hitch has a tongue weight capacity of 350 lbs, using the adapter will reduce that capacity to 175 lbs. That's not a big deal for the flat towed vehicle, because flat towed vehicles are a rolling load that don't exert any...

  • Dual Hitch Receiver Adapter For Tow Dolly And Bike Rack
    We do have a dual hitch receiver adapter that will allow you to use your tow dolly while also carrying your bike rack. The only thing you need to know is the amount of rise or drop you'll need, which will allow you to choose the right one. To determine this, just measure from the ground to the top of your motorhome's receiver, and then measure from the ground to the bottom of your dolly's coupler, and the difference you get is the rise or drop you'll require. If your motorhome's hitch...

  • Bike Rack Solution for Towing Rockwood 2318 ESP
    I have a great solution for you with the Jack-It part # LC429756 which attaches under your trailer jack mounting flange and gives you a 2 bike rack that carries the bikes above it. Using a hitch adapter ends up cutting the hitch capacity in half so it's not what we normally recommend. This is due to added leverage and movement created. The Jack It though gives you ability to carry bikes in same area, not have to worry about clearance issues, and does not cut capacity so it's the way to go.

  • Dual Hitch Adapter that Can be Used When Towing or with Tow Dolly
    The company that designed the # RM-077-10 (Roadmaster) primarily works with vehicle flat towing which is what they intended this adapter for. The towing capacity of this is 10,000 lbs which refers to the weight of the vehicle being flat towed and the tongue weight capacity of 400 lbs refers to the weight it can carry with a hitch accessory in the upper hitch opening. The most similar adapter we have would be the # MPG544 that can be used when towing or with a tow dolly.
